Role Overview Epicured is seeking an experienced Procurement Manager to lead high-volume food and packaging purchasing across our operations. This role owns millions of dollars in monthly spend, manages hundreds of SKUs, and partners closely with culinary leadership, production supervisors, fulfillment teams, and inventory/receiving across multiple facilities. The ideal candidate is highly analytical, operationally sharp, relationship-driven, and comfortable operating in a fast-paced food production environment with real scale and complexity. Key Responsibilities Procurement & Purchasing Leadership (Primary Focus) * Own daily purchasing operations, with approximately 80% food ingredients and 20% packaging and supplies. * Manage weekly ordering of 500+ food ingredients (fresh, frozen, and dry). * Oversee weekly purchasing in multi-million-dollar monthly spend. * Procure packaging for: * Medically tailored ready-to-eat meals * Pantry items * E-commerce and Amazon fulfillment * Enterprise and institutional partners (elder care, sports nutrition, clinical trials) * Medicaid member meal and pantry programs * Purchase corrugated boxes, ice packs, containers, labels, and shipping materials supporting 10,000+ meals shipped weekly. * Manage fulfillment, factory, and office supplies (25+ SKUs weekly including tape, labels, paper, ink, and operational consumables). Vendor Management & Sourcing * Build, maintain, and manage 25+ active vendor relationships across food and packaging categories. * Communicate daily with vendors regarding: * Product specifications * Pricing and MOQs * Lead times and delivery schedules * Shortages, substitutions, and quality issues * Track and report on vendor accuracy, reliability, and performance. * Source new vendors and negotiate pricing and terms to improve cost efficiency while maintaining quality. * Proactively establish new supplier relationships to support growth, redundancy, and innovation. Cross-Functional Collaboration * Partner closely with: * Culinary leadership (Executive Chef, Kitchen Managers) to ensure accurate ingredient restocking for menus and rotations. * Production & Fulfillment teams, collaborating with 10+ supervisors to align purchasing with production schedules. * Inventory & Receiving teams in Glen Cove and Staten Island to coordinate deliveries, shortages, and usage tracking. * Communicate shortages, delivery timing, and substitutions clearly and proactively to all stakeholders. Data, Reporting & Systems * Maintain highly accurate procurement, pricing, and inventory records using advanced Excel dashboards. * Track ingredient costs, pricing trends, MOQs, lead times, substitutions, and usage patterns. * Utilize advanced Excel functions including: * VLOOKUP / XLOOKUP * Pivot tables * Forecasting formulas * Conditional formatting * Inventory and cost dashboards * Support audit checks and procurement controls. * Assist with the implementation and adoption of a new ERP system. * Maintain organized digital and physical documentation (Dropbox and on-site records).
